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4515 335361 508 26971482249 5457
020153842 39446781115
020153842 39446781115
5961 8242714986 755 889
All about undefined
Interested in learning more?
020153842 39446781115
5961 8242714986 755 889
See more
95733 8992109 36
5810 67 808 638570
See more
29037 3542190 7569
94 2636677 6715 601
See more